Output 43dcbf427485cc21e98c263c0a19f0c9d2526cbebc9d785d51c5190452396a28:0

value
186067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ee08e159c91d794d620f1ff8eafe62ab9ee0209 OP_EQUAL
address
3HdgWH6hof1QYG4nLyw3yTMq4spSb9mGj3
transaction
43dcbf427485cc21e98c263c0a19f0c9d2526cbebc9d785d51c5190452396a28
spent
true